The cheapest way to get from Santa Fe Depot to Pacific Beach is to drive which costs $1 - $3 and takes 12 min.
The fastest way to get from Santa Fe Depot to Pacific Beach is to taxi which takes 12 min and costs $35 - $50.
The distance between Santa Fe Depot and Pacific Beach is 9 miles. The road distance is 8 miles.
The best way to get from Santa Fe Depot to Pacific Beach without a car is to tram and line 30 bus which takes 30 min and costs .
It takes approximately 30 min to get from Santa Fe Depot to Pacific Beach,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Santa Fe Depot to Pacific Beach is 8 miles. It takes approximately 12 min to drive from Santa Fe Depot to Pacific Beach.

There is no direct connection from Santa Fe Depot to Pacific Beach. However, you can take the vehicle to Old Town Station, walk to Old Town Transit Center, then take the line 8 bus to Grand Av & Ingraham St.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Santa Fe Depot to Grand Av & Ingraham St via Balboa Avenue Station and Balboa Avenue Transit Center in around 40 min.
